André Chailleux was a French painter born in 1912 and known for his contributions to the modern art movement. He was associated with the École de Paris and gained recognition for his use of color and abstract forms. Chailleux's works often reflect a blend of figurative and abstract styles, showcasing his innovative approach to painting. He passed away in 1999, leaving behind a significant legacy in contemporary art.
